Historical Context and Industry Foundations
Originally introduced in the late 19th century, mechanical slot machines such as the iconic Liberty Bell created the foundation for gambling entertainment. By the 1970s, the advent of electronic video slots revolutionized the industry, increasing game complexity and player engagement. Today, we’re witnessing a new era driven by digital innovation, which emphasizes personalization, gamification, and social interaction.
Technological Innovations in Digital Slots
The shift to online platforms has enabled developers to push technological boundaries. Key innovations include:
- Random Number Generators (RNGs): Ensuring fair play and unpredictability, RNGs are rigorously tested by industry regulators, building trust with players.
- High-Definition Graphics & Sound Design: Creating immersive environments that mimic or surpass land-based experiences.
- Gamification Elements: Incorporation of bonus rounds, achievements, and leaderboards to enhance user engagement.
- Mobile Optimization: Ensuring seamless gameplay across devices, including smartphones and tablets.
Market Data and Player Engagement Trends
Data from industry reports indicates a robust growth trajectory for online slots, with the global market size surpassing $60 billion in 2022, projected to grow at a CAGR of approximately 8% over the next five years. The increasing adoption of smartphones and high-speed internet has democratized access, leading to a diversified player base.
| Trend | Description | Impact |
|---|---|---|
| Personalization & Customization | Slots offer tailored experiences based on player preferences and behavior data. | Increases retention and lifetime value. |
| Live Features & Social Gaming | Integration of social features, including shared jackpots and multiplayer modes. | Boosts engagement and viral sharing. |
| Crypto Integration | Use of cryptocurrencies for deposits and withdrawals adds anonymity and speed. | Fosters inclusivity and new market entrants. |

Expert Perspectives on Future Trajectories
Looking forward, the convergence of artificial intelligence (AI), augmented reality (AR), and blockchain technology promises a transformative impact on online slots. AI-driven personalization will refine player experiences, while AR could create augmented environments for gameplay. Blockchain integration aims to ensure transparency, security, and decentralized gaming ecosystems.
Moreover, regulatory frameworks will continue to evolve, requiring operators to innovate within compliance boundaries to sustain growth. Industry leaders are investing heavily in R&D, and partnerships with technology firms are expected to catalyze new game formats and engagement models.
